Odisha Government Orders Seizure of Vehicles Without Fitness Certificates

In a bid to enhance road safety and ensure compliance with vehicle regulations, the Odisha government has mandated the seizure of vehicles operating without valid fitness certificates. Transport Commissioner Amitabh Thakur has issued a directive to transport authorities, emphasizing stringent action against such violations.

According to an official statement released on Tuesday, Thakur’s circular instructs officers to take decisive measures against vehicle owners who fail to maintain valid fitness and registration certificates. The directive encompasses not only the imposition of fines but also the seizure of non-compliant vehicles and the filing of legal cases against the owners.

“This measure is crucial to ensure that all vehicles on the road are fit for operation, thereby reducing the risk of accidents and ensuring the safety of the public,” Thakur stated. The circular highlights the government’s commitment to strict enforcement of vehicle fitness regulations as a cornerstone of its road safety strategy.

The transport authorities have been asked to conduct thorough inspections and crackdowns on vehicles without proper documentation. This initiative is expected to significantly reduce the number of unfit vehicles on the roads, thereby mitigating potential hazards.

Vehicle owners are advised to ensure their vehicles have up-to-date fitness and registration certificates to avoid penalties and legal action. The Odisha government’s proactive stance is aimed at fostering a safer driving environment and encouraging compliance with essential vehicle regulations.
